Job Title: Health & Wellness Coach I or II 

Status: part-time

Hours:  opening shift 5am-9am: Tues, Thurs, and Fri, additional hours available

Wage:  Level I - starts at $13.85/hr, Level II - $16.00/hr, depends on experience 

Reports to: Health & Wellness Director 

Probation: Subject to a 12-month introductory (probationary) period

POSITION SUMMARY: The Health & Wellness Coach (HWC) provides fitness instruction and safety to all members through scheduled orientations and ongoing opportunities to teach and reinforce updated exercise techniques and general fitness principles. The HWC enforces rules and policies of the YMCA Health Center and the Association in a positive and consistent manner. They will take responsibility for the condition and cleanliness of the Health Center and all equipment. The HWC provides members with a quality fitness experience that reflects a positive image of the YMCA.

Requirements

  • HWC I: High school diploma or general education degree (GED); or three to six months related experience and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ience.
  • Educational background and/or experience in strength training and general fitness and/or group exercise instruction.
  • Communication, leadership and motivational skills.
  • HWC II: Aditionally, employee must be either a Certified Personal Trainer or a certified Group Exercise Instructor. 
  • Current CPR certification and basic first aid training.
  • Working knowledge of anatomy, kinesiology and safe exercise technique.
